The 'Amulet' series by Kazu Kibuishi is one of those graphic novel gems that feels tailor-made for a movie adaptation, but unfortunately, nothing official has materialized yet. I’ve scoured forums, news sites, and even reached out to fellow fans, and the consensus is the same: no greenlit projects. The closest we’ve gotten are whispers of interest from studios, but no casting, no trailers, nada.

That said, the series’ popularity keeps hope alive. The story’s mix of steampunk, magic, and emotional depth—paired with Kibuishi’s stunning art—would translate beautifully to film. Imagine the lost city of Cielis or the mechanical rabbit Miskit brought to life with modern CGI. Fans have even created mock trailers and concept art, which just proves how much demand there is.

Until then, I’ll keep my fingers crossed and my 'Amulet' books on the shelf, ready to reread whenever the craving hits. Maybe one day we’ll see Emily and Navin’s adventures in theaters, but for now, the graphic novels remain the only way to experience this world.

How many volumes are there in the amulet books pdf series?

3 Answers2025-07-05 14:23:27
'Amulet' by Kazu Kibuishi is one of my absolute favorites. The series currently has nine volumes out, each packed with stunning artwork and an epic storyline. From 'The Stonekeeper' to 'Waverider', the series keeps expanding, and I love how each book builds on the last. The blend of fantasy, adventure, and family drama makes it a must-read. I remember binge-reading the first few volumes in one sitting because the plot twists were so gripping. If you're into graphic novels, this series is a gem. For those curious about the latest updates, the ninth volume was released in 2023, and there might be more coming. The author hasn't confirmed if it's the final installment, so fingers crossed! The PDF versions are widely available, but I highly recommend the physical copies for the full visual experience.

What age group is the amulet books pdf series suitable for?

3 Answers2025-07-05 13:33:50
'The Amulet' series by Kazu Kibuishi is one of those gems that transcends age groups. The story is packed with adventure, fantasy, and emotional depth, making it perfect for middle-grade readers around 8-12 years old. The artwork is stunning and accessible, which helps younger readers stay engaged, while the plot’s complexity and darker themes—like loss and responsibility—resonate with older kids and even teens. I’ve seen adults enjoy it too, especially if they’re into visually rich storytelling. The series doesn’t talk down to its audience, which is why it appeals to such a broad range. It’s a great bridge for kids moving from picture books to more text-heavy novels, but the action and world-building keep older readers hooked.

Does the amulet books pdf series have an anime adaptation?

4 Answers2025-07-05 03:57:29
I’ve been keeping a close eye on 'The Amulet' series by Kazu Kibuishi for years. The graphic novels have a massive following, blending fantasy, adventure, and stunning artwork, which makes them prime material for an anime adaptation. However, as of now, there hasn’t been any official announcement or confirmation about an anime version. The series’ visual style and epic storytelling would translate beautifully into animation, but studios haven’t picked it up yet. Fans have been speculating and hoping for years, especially since the series has all the elements that make for a successful anime—magic, strong characters, and a richly built world. Until there’s concrete news, I’d recommend diving into the graphic novels if you haven’t already. They’re a fantastic read, and the artwork alone is worth it. If an anime does get greenlit someday, it’ll likely be a big hit given the source material’s quality.
